>>A CULLOMPTON councillor has raised the alarm over what he says are mounting breaches of safety and environmental rules at a major housing development on Tiverton Road - warning that heavy construction traffic poses a growing danger to schoolchildren.
-
Speaking at a meeting of Cullompton Town Council, Councillor James Buczkowski confirmed he had submitted a formal complaint to Mid Devon District Council's planning enforcement team.
